Topic: First term miscarriage
Posted By: kimevans
Subject: First term miscarriage
Date Posted: 27 June 2017 at 8:35am
So my SO and I decided to try for another baby our wee girl is 6 now. I was so stoked when I found out I was pregnant. On Sunday I statred to spot and then bleed. Now it's official the pregnancy is gone.

I'm devastated I just keep randomly crying. My partner wants to help but doesn't know what to do. How do I cope and move on?
